概括
这项研究引入了一种初级-三级共享护理模型,以促进家族高胆固醇血症 (FH) 的检测,这是一种增加心血管疾病风险的遗传疾病. 早期发现和治疗FH对于预防早发性心脏病至关重要.

背景情况:
- 家族性高胆固醇血症 (FH) 是一种遗传性脂质代谢障碍,导致心血管疾病的早发.
- 目前的FH检测率很低,尽管这是一个高度可治疗的疾病.
- 早期发现和治疗FH显著降低心脏病发病率和死亡率.
研究的目的:
- 实施和评估初级-三级共享护理模式,以提高FH检测率.
- 评估在FH进行基因测试的支持包的实施情况.
- 加强在初级和三级保健机构中识别患有FH的个人.
主要方法:
- 一个混合方法的前后实施研究设计.
- 在澳大利亚新南威尔士州,在12个月内实施一级三级共享护理模式.
- 评估实施结果,包括可接受性,可行性,准确性和成本,使用定量和定性数据.
主要成果:
- 计划收集至少62名指数患者和类似的历史组的数据.
- 大约20个半结构面试将进行,以获得定性见解.
- 专注于评估共享护理模式的成功整合和有效性.
结论:
- 该研究协议概述了一种全面的方法来评估用于FH检测的新型共享护理模型.
- 预计成功实施将改善FH的早期识别和管理.
- 这些发现将为减少与FH相关的心血管疾病负担的策略提供信息.

Primary Healthcare Services
Primary care promotes wellness and prevents disease. This care includes health promotion, education, protection (such as immunizations), early disease screening, and environmental considerations. Settings providing this type of healthcare include physician offices, public health clinics, school nursing, and community health nursing.

Levels of Health Promotion and Illness Prevention
Health promotion allows a person to control the determinants of health, resulting in an improved health status. It enhances the quality of life and reduces premature deaths. Health promotion and illness prevention programs help people make beneficial choices to reduce the risk of disease and disabilities. There are three health promotion and illness prevention levels: primary, secondary, and tertiary prevention.
